반응형

전체 글 796

MongoDB로 보고하는 방법은 무엇입니까?

MongoDB로 보고하는 방법은 무엇입니까? 다음 큰 프로젝트를 위해 MongoDB를 고려하고 있습니다만, 몇 가지 우려 사항이 있습니다.특히 보고는 어떻게 해야 하나요? 제가 알기로는 관계형 데이터베이스에서 일반적으로 수행하는 것과 같은 종류의 조인 및 집계를 수행할 수 없습니다.제가 염두에 둔 보고에는 엄격한 기준을 가진 다양한 "표"의 많은 데이터를 집계하는 것이 포함됩니다. 이것은 MongoDB에서 쉽게 할 수 있습니까, 아니면 큰 골칫거리가 될 것입니까?Pentaho 및 Jaspersoft 및 기타 레거시 보고 솔루션은 MongoDB에서 데이터를 펌핑할 수 있는 방법이 있지만 MongoDB 데이터에 대한 분석 및 보고를 위해 명시적으로 설계된 두 가지 새로운 솔루션이 있습니다. JSON 스튜디오..

programing 2023.07.08

numpy 배열을 mongodb에 저장하는 중

numpy 배열을 mongodb에 저장하는 중 MongoDB 문서 두 개가 있는데, my the fields 중 하나가 매트릭스(numpy array)로 가장 잘 표현됩니다.이 문서를 MongoDB에 저장하고 싶은데 어떻게 해야 하나요? { 'name' : 'subject1', 'image_name' : 'blah/foo.png', 'feature1' : np.array(...) } 1D Numpy 배열의 경우 목록을 사용할 수 있습니다. # serialize 1D array x record['feature1'] = x.tolist() # deserialize 1D array x x = np.fromiter( record['feature1'] ) 다차원 데이터의 경우 피클과 피몬고를 사용해야 할 것 같습..

programing 2023.07.08

오류: 다른 경로에서 생성된 ActivatedRouteSnapshot을 다시 연결할 수 없습니다.

오류: 다른 경로에서 생성된 ActivatedRouteSnapshot을 다시 연결할 수 없습니다. 나는 그것을 구현하기 위해 노력하고 있습니다.RouteReuseStrategy클래스입니다. 최상위 경로로 이동할 때 잘 작동합니다. 경로에 자식 경로가 있고 자식 경로로 이동한 후 최상위 경로로 다시 이동하면 다음 오류가 발생합니다. 오류: 발견되지 않음(약속 없음):오류: 다른 경로에서 생성된 ActivatedRouteSnapshot을 다시 연결할 수 없습니다. 오류를 보여주기 위해 플런커를 만들었습니다.IE 11에서는 플런커가 작동하지 않습니다. 최신 버전의 Chrome에서 확인하십시오. 오류를 재현하는 단계: 1단계: 2단계 3단계 4단계 콘솔에서 오류를 볼 수 있습니다. 이 문서에서 발견된 구현을 시..

programing 2023.07.08

CouchDB, MongoDB 및 Redis 중 Node.js로 시작하기에 좋은 데이터베이스는 무엇입니까?

CouchDB, MongoDB 및 Redis 중 Node.js로 시작하기에 좋은 데이터베이스는 무엇입니까? 저는 Node.js에 더 관심을 가지고 즐기고 있습니다.저는 웹 애플리케이션 개발 쪽으로 더 옮겨가고 있습니다. 나는 Node.js에 머리를 싸매고 현재 프런트 엔드로 Backbone을 사용하고 있습니다.저는 백본을 사용하여 RESTful API를 사용하여 서버와 통신하는 몇 가지 애플리케이션을 만들고 있습니다.Node.js에서는 Express 프레임워크를 사용합니다. 서버에 간단한 데이터베이스가 필요한 시점에 도달했습니다.저는 포스트그레에 익숙합니다.장고를 사용하는 SQL과 MySQL이지만, 여기서 필요한 것은 간단한 데이터 스토리지 등입니다.CouchDB, MongoDB 및 Redis에 대해 알..

programing 2023.07.08

SQL - 열의 고유한 조합을 카운트하는 방법

SQL - 열의 고유한 조합을 카운트하는 방법 이것이 가능한지는 잘 모르겠지만 표의 고유 값 수를 세고 싶습니다.고유 폴더 수를 세는 방법을 알고 있습니다.내가 하는 ID: select count(folderid) from folder 하지만 나는 폴더 테이블에 있는 folderid와 userid의 고유한 조합의 개수를 알고 싶습니다.이것을 할 수 있는 방법이 있습니까?select count(*) from ( select distinct folderid, userid from folder ) select count(*) from ( select folderId, userId from folder group by folderId, userId ) t 이렇게 하면 고유한 folderid 및 userid 조합..

programing 2023.07.08

Oracle Client란 무엇입니까?

Oracle Client란 무엇입니까? 저는 MySQL 배경에서 왔으며 Oracle을 처음 접하는 사람입니다.알고싶습니다 Oracle Client의 의미는 무엇입니까? 그게 무슨 소용이 있습니까? MySQL에 해당하는 것은 무엇입니까? 감사해요. Oracle Client의 의미는 무엇입니까? 그리고. 그게 무슨 소용이 있습니까? 이 경우 클라이언트는 응용프로그램의 기본 데이터베이스에 원격으로 연결할 수 있는 클래스 라이브러리(DLL)입니다.항상 같은 컨텍스트 내에 있는 클라이언트를 a라고 할 수도 있습니다. 작업 중인 기본 데이터베이스 엔진을 기반으로 여러 데이터 공급자가 있을 수 있습니다. Microsoft에서 제공한 (사용되지 않음)가 있습니다. 실제로 지금까지 구축된 Oracle 클라이언트 중 가장..

programing 2023.07.03

배열이 정의되지 않았거나 초기 크기가 없음을 선언하려면 어떻게 해야 합니까?

배열이 정의되지 않았거나 초기 크기가 없음을 선언하려면 어떻게 해야 합니까? 다음을 사용하여 수행할 수 있다는 것을 알고 있습니다.malloc하지만 아직 사용법을 모릅니다. 예를 들어, 나는 사용자가 스톱을 넣기 위해 Sentinel과 함께 무한 루프를 사용하여 여러 개의 숫자를 입력하기를 원했지만(예: -1), 나는 아직 그/그녀가 몇 개를 입력할지 모르기 때문에 초기 크기가 없는 배열을 선언해야 합니다.하지만 이 인트라[]처럼 작동하지 않는다는 것도 알고 있습니다. 컴파일할 때는 정해진 수의 요소가 있어야 하기 때문입니다. intar[1000]와 같이 과장된 크기로 선언하면 효과가 있겠지만, 멍청하게 느껴집니다(그리고 1000 정수 바이트를 메모리에 할당하기 때문에 메모리가 낭비됩니다). 이를 수행하..

programing 2023.07.03

UI 팬 제스처 인식기 - 수직 또는 수평만

UI 팬 제스처 인식기 - 수직 또는 수평만 저는 다음과 같은 견해를 가지고 있습니다.UIPanGestureRecognizer보기를 수직으로 끕니다.그래서 인식기 콜백에서는 y 좌표만 업데이트하여 이동합니다.이 뷰의 개요는 다음과 같습니다.UIPanGestureRecognizerX 좌표만 업데이트하면 보기가 수평으로 끌립니다. 문제는 첫째가UIPanGestureRecognizer보기를 수직으로 이동하기 위해 이벤트를 수행하는 중이므로 수퍼뷰 제스처를 사용할 수 없습니다. 난 시도했다. - (BOOL)gestureRecognizer:(UIGestureRecognizer *)gestureRecognizer shouldRecognizeSimultaneouslyWithGestureRecognizer: (UIGe..

programing 2023.07.03

Quartz 사용법메일을 트리거하는 작업을 예약하기 위해 ASP.NET을 사용하는 net?

Quartz 사용법메일을 트리거하는 작업을 예약하기 위해 ASP.NET을 사용하는 net? ASP.NET에서 Quartz.dll을 사용하는 방법을 모르겠습니다.매일 아침 메일을 트리거하는 작업을 예약하기 위한 코드는 어디에 작성해야 합니까?수행할 작업과 설정 방법에 따라 몇 가지 옵션이 있습니다.예를 들어 Quartz를 설치할 수 있습니다.Net 서버를 독립 실행형 Windows 서비스로 사용하거나 asp.net 응용 프로그램에 포함시킬 수도 있습니다. 임베디드로 실행하려면 다음과 같이 global.asax로 서버를 시작할 수 있습니다(소스 코드 예제 #12 참조). NameValueCollection properties = new NameValueCollection(); properties["quart..

programing 2023.07.03

MongoClient.connect()를 사용할 때 sslprep 주의

MongoClient.connect()를 사용할 때 sslprep 주의 NodeJS/express API를 작성하고 있는데 mongo 서버에 연결할 때 다음과 같은 경고가 발생합니다. Warning: no saslprep library specified. Passwords will not be sanitized 설명서나 github/google에서 이 경고에 대한 언급을 찾을 수 없습니다. OS(linux) 라이브러리가 누락되었거나 노드 패키지가 누락되었습니까? 다음은 연결 코드 샘플입니다. const client = await MongoClient.connect(`mongodb://${auth[0]}:${auth[1]}@${url}/admin`, { useNewUrlParser: true }); thi..

programing 2023.07.03
반응형